The PC_DBG_ECO_CNTL register on the Adreno A5xx family gets
programmed to some different values on a per-model basis.
At least, this is what we intend to do here;

Unfortunately, though, this register is being overwritten with a
static magic number, right after applying the GPU-specific
configuration (including the GPU-specific quirks) and that is
effectively nullifying the efforts.

Let's remove the redundant and wrong write to the PC_DBG_ECO_CNTL
register in order to retain the wanted configuration for the
target GPU.

Similar to commit &lt;b82175750131&gt;("drm/amdgpu: fix IH overflow on Vega10 v2").
When an ring buffer overflow happens the appropriate bit is set in the WPTR
register which is also written back to memory. But clearing the bit in the
WPTR doesn't trigger another memory writeback.

So what can happen is that we end up processing the buffer overflow over and
over again because the bit is never cleared. Resulting in a random system
lockup because of an infinite loop in an interrupt handler.

The BXT/GLK DPLL can't generate certain frequencies. We already
reject the 233-240MHz range on both. But on GLK the DPLL max
frequency was bumped from 300MHz to 594MHz, so now we get to
also worry about the 446-480MHz range (double the original
problem range). Reject any frequency within the higher
problematic range as well.
